Marvel’s Avengers Unveils New Hawkeye Mission Details

Marvel’s Avengers are almost ready to pull back the curtain for the newest hero participating in the game, Hawkeye, which will take place at the next war table on the 16th. Now the game has revealed several new details about Clint Barton’s new mission content in a new summary, which they released as a tease for the war table with a countdown. Hawkeye gets a full revelation at the War Table, including a look at how he plays, but now we know a little more why he sees characters like the Maestro in the footage we’ve seen so far. ‘After the A-day disaster, Clint Barton and his mentee, Kate Bishop, were left on their own and decided to search for the missing Nick Fury, thus coming across AIM’s secret Tachyon project, which Clint captured. Although Kate brought him back to the Avengers, the danger does not leave him; he falls into a coma and sees a vision of the future that leaves him confused and defeated when he finally wakes up. Armed with his bow, sword and knowledge of the gloomy events. to come, it’s up to Hawkeye to stop the end of the world. ‘

Those who complete the goal will remember that Kate and the rest of the Hawkeye team save from the other reality before the gate closes, and the whole team then talks and tells stories about the Chimera. Hawkeye is happy to be back, and they ask him what the future holds for them.

He shows snippets of what he saw in future reality. He says they are being attacked by an alien race known as the Kree, and it is an “invasion that he says will end the world as we know it.” Future Monica works with Nick Fury to save the earth, and she tries to bring Clint to the past to fix it. He does not know when they are coming or why, and says they are completely excessive unless they do something. Captain America is all on board to get to work, but then Clint leaves, and we do not know why.

Now we do, since that’s probably the coma they’re referring to. It is then possible that the future vision is where he meets the Maestro, and from there who knows. However, we can not wait to find out more, and the good news is that we do not have to wait much longer.
